I find it common during a social gathering that the conversation winds around to a topic that motivates me to want to share some of my images or a project that pertains to the topic at hand. I've learned, however, that trying to share my artwork at such moments is not only futile but disruptive. Instead, I find it more productive to wait until the next day and to email a link to the work on my website. I've found that almost everyone will then look at the work — on their schedule, away from the social scene, where they can give it more attention and almost always respond back to me.
